**Building Access — Guest Wi-Fi Desk (Coralhurst Reception)**

Visiting contractors connect to the guest network at the small desk left of reception. A receptionist registers your device and issues a daily voucher; connectivity lapses at 19:00 sharp. The desk terminal itself stays locked outside staffed hours. Contractors working late who need the terminal unlocked should enter the following.

door code, bagef-yafop: bdg-ZFZML-07646

FAQ: How does the waveform preview in Chorusline get generated? When a clip lands in the ingest queue, the Renderlet worker downsamples audio to 800 peak pairs and caches the result as JSON next to the asset. If peaks look flat, check that the normalization pass ran; silence detection can skip clips under 300ms. Re-rendering is safe and idempotent — just requeue the asset. To requeue from the locked ops console, you must first unlock it with the recovery passphrase, which is:

vault phrase of hawif-bahof = novvan-belius-istael-fenvan-holdor-druox-eliath

Handover Note — Subscription Tier Launch (Director to Director)

Hi Priya — handing the "Kestrel Select" tier over to you as I move to the Ravensholt project. Short version for the branch managers: pricing is locked, collateral ships next week, and training decks are in the shared drive. The Millbrook branch piloted it and their feedback is folded in already. Watch the discount-stacking issue; it bit us twice in testing. One more thing you'll want to share carefully with the branches.

board note of fahag-tajop: The eastern region missed its Julix quota by 44.0 percent last quarter. Ralionax Holdings plans to lower the Druath list price by 61.8 percent in March. The board signed off on a budget of $295.0 million for Project Gilath. The renewal with Ruswynix Systems closes at $274.5 million a year, 17.0 percent above the last contract.